Greenplum catalog find table owner
WebDec 23, 2014 · select * from pg_tables where tableowner = 'user1'; Test instead with: select * from pg_tables where tablename = 'my_tbl'; You should see two or more rows for the same table name ... Of just use schema-qualified table names to avoid possible confusion: ALTER TABLE my_schema.my_tbl OWNER TO user1; SELECT * FROM … WebFor anyone trying to find indexes in a populated database: this query works great, but change the and t.relname like 'test%' line to the table (s) you want, or erase that line completely to find all indexes in your db. – Erik J Sep 26, 2013 at 21:08 1 Could someone explain what relkind='r' means? – Qwerty Jan 29, 2015 at 9:13 7
Greenplum catalog find table owner
Did you know?
WebSo i have similar to schema privileges queries for table, views, columns, sequences, functions, database and even default privileges. Also, there is helpful extension pg_permission where I get logic for provided queries and just upgraded it for my purposes. Share Improve this answer Follow answered May 3, 2024 at 12:50 Volodymyr Vintonyak … WebMar 1, 2024 · Important updates for Postgres 15! The release notes: Remove PUBLIC creation permission on the public schema (Noah Misch) And: Change the owner of the public schema to be the new pg_database_owner role (Noah Misch) You can still change that any way you like. It's just the new, safer, more restrictive default. Follow the link for …
WebJul 23, 2024 · Since you're changing the ownership for all tables, you likely want views and sequences too. Here's what I did: Tables: for tbl in `psql -qAt -c "select tablename from pg_tables where schemaname = 'public';" YOUR_DB` ; do psql -c "alter table \"$tbl\" owner to NEW_OWNER" YOUR_DB ; done Sequences: Web346. The following query gives names of all sequences. SELECT c.relname FROM pg_class c WHERE c.relkind = 'S'; Typically a sequence is named as $ {table}_id_seq. Simple regex pattern matching will give you the table name. To get last value of a sequence use the following query: SELECT last_value FROM test_id_seq; Share.
WebThis will list all tables the current user has access to, not only those that are owned by the current user: select * from information_schema.tables where table_schema not in … WebCheck your table schema here SELECT * FROM information_schema.columns For example if a table is on the default schema public both this will works ok SELECT * FROM parroquias_region SELECT * FROM public.parroquias_region But sectors need specify the schema SELECT * FROM map_update.sectores_point Share Improve this answer Follow
WebGreenplum offers a binary for the Ubuntu Operating System. It can be installed via the apt-get command with the Ubuntu Personal Package Archive system. It can be installed via …
WebMay 15, 2024 · The next step is to update tables ownership for each database: psql old_name_db old_name_db=# REASSIGN OWNED BY old_name TO new_name; This must be performed on each DB owned by 'old_name'. The command will update ownership of all tables in the DB. Share Follow edited Apr 27, 2024 at 7:08 answered Apr 30, 2024 … sbc master pension trust credit ratingWebNov 22, 2024 · 1.get all tables and views from information_schema.tables, include those of information_schema and pg_catalog. select * from information_schema.tables 2.get … sbc maple ridgeWebAug 11, 2011 · Cluster > Catalog > Schema > Table > Columns & Rows So in both Postgres and the SQL Standard we have this containment hierarchy: A computer may have one cluster or multiple. A database … sbc material validation workshopWebFeb 9, 2024 · Name of table. tableowner name (references pg_authid.rolname) Name of table's owner. tablespace name (references pg_tablespace.spcname) Name of … should i refile my 2020 taxesWebNov 3, 2024 · Command Center users with Basic permission can view details about the tables in a Greenplum database. Select Table Browser to view the Command Center … sbc manifold vacuum fittingWebWell, I didn't find a one-step process, but this takes care of all the objects I can see in my database: update pg_class SET relowner = (SELECT oid FROM pg_roles WHERE rolname = 'foo') where relnamespace = (select oid from pg_namespace where nspname = 'public' limit 1); update pg_proc set proowner = (select oid from pg_roles where rolname = 'foo') … sbc mathWebDec 11, 2010 · SELECT schema_name, pg_size_pretty(sum(table_size)::bigint), (sum(table_size) / pg_database_size(current_database())) * 100 FROM ( SELECT pg_catalog.pg_namespace.nspname as schema_name, pg_relation_size(pg_catalog.pg_class.oid) as table_size FROM pg_catalog.pg_class … sbc marine exhaust manifolds